Dominik Mysterio will put his North American Title on the line at NXT No Mercy.
On the September 5th episode of NXT, Mustafa Ali took on Dragon Lee in a North American Championship number one contender match. To add some extra spice, current champion Dominik Mysterio appeared as the special guest referee.
Unsurprisingly, the match ended in controversy, with Lee complaining about a slow count following a Liger Bomb. However, it was a decision that would immediately come back to haunt him.
Ali took advantage of the uncertainty and rolled up Lee, with Mysterio delivering a fast three-count.
Although he was on the end of the decision, Ali was less than impressed with how the scene played out and flattened Mysterio with a right hand after the bell.
At present, three matches have been confirmed for No Mercy, with the card headlined by the NXT Title clash between champion Carmelo Hayes and Ilja Dragunov or Wes Lee. Elsewhere, Noam Dar will defend the Heritage Cup against the winner of the Global Heritage Invitational Tournament.
When Did Dominik Mysterio Win The North American Title?
Dominik Mysterio won the North American Title on July 18th, getting the better of Wes Lee. Since then he’s defended the gold against Butch, Sami Zayn, and Dragon Lee, as well as emerging as the winner in a Triple Threat Match featuring Wes Lee and Mustafa Ali at the Great American Bash.
Set to defend the title against Dragon Lee, Mysterio is not intimidated by his opponent, describing him as nothing more than a cheap copy of his father.
